What's the cheapest way for transferring money to Anguilla from San Marino?

One of the most important things to watch out for is hidden fees when sending money to Anguilla from San Marino. Most of the time, you will get ripped off if you have no choice, or very few choices. For instance, if you send money to Anguilla using your bank, you are most likely paying high fees. You may also not be getting the best exchange rate on your East Caribbean Dollar foreign exchange transaction.

RemitFinder partners with many money transfer companies that provide you with cheap options to ensure you get the best EUR to Anguilla exchange rate. The more choices you have, the better yield you get. This is because you can get creative with exchange rates and fees to determine the cheapest option for you. For instance, one company may be giving a very high rate but charging a steep fee as well, while another provider may have a slightly lower rate, but 0 fee. All of this also depends on how much amount you send. It is very much possible that as the transaction amount varies, one money transfer operator gives a better return than the other, and vice versa.

How to send money from San Marino to Anguilla fast?

The speed of your Euro to East Caribbean Dollar funds transfer will depend on various factors like which provider you use, how you pay for your transaction, how you choose for your recipient to get the funds, etc. You will, therefore, want to compare various options to see which one suits your needs best.

We created a comprehensive guide on remittances to help you understand all the factors that come into play when you convert EUR to XCD. Establishing a solid understanding of all the criteria that affect your transaction speed will help you compare various money transfer companies to see which one can provide you with the fastest transaction.

One possible approach that will help you send money fast to Anguilla from San Marino is to rely on cash as payment as well as delivery method. This would mean paying for your transfer with cash, most likely by walking into your provider's office or agent location. Similarly, your recipient could also pick up cash in Anguilla if they have a pickup location nearby. Dealing with cash on both sides will eliminate bank transfers in the middle which generally take longer as money has to move between banks.

One drawback of cash transfers is the need to go to physical drop off and pickup locations, and the inherent risk involved in carrying cash, especially for larger amounts. Another one is that cash transfers generally involve lower exchange rates as compared to online transfers. If you do not want to handle cash for the aforementioned reasons, the next fastest transfers would be to payout XCD into a mobile wallet, or even do a mobile airtime popup. These methods would be faster than San Marino bank to Anguilla bank transfer.

Step by step guide to send money to Anguilla from San Marino

Follow the below easy steps to send money to Anguilla from San Marino.

  • If you are sending money for the first time with a provider, register an account with them. You will likely get a validation email, and optionally a validation text on your mobile as well. This ensures that it is indeed you who is creating your account.
  • You will also need to provide your national ID with a photo, and proof of address. Providing this information ensures the security of your account and helps in fraud prevention.
  • Add your payment method - this is how you pay for your transfer. Generally, you would want to use your San Marino bank account to fund your transaction.
  • Add your recipient - provide details about who will receive the funds (can also be your own account in Anguilla).
  • Specify delivery method - specify how the recipient will get the proceeds. Choosing a bank account is usually the best, if one is available.
  • Add the transfer amount and start the transaction.

The provider will then work on your EUR to XCD remittance, and you should not have any additional action to take. Keep an eye on your email inbox as you should get notified about the progress of your transaction.
